Output 259962e76a1c0581c04a85d0f275c621c860d5a681c91e99fae2f375827f3926:2

value
125559274
script pubkey
OP_0 OP_PUSHBYTES_20 69cef7113c86d4dfcfdf49e04b46219b72ec076f
address
bc1qd880wyfusm2dln7lf8syk33pndewcpm06mn5c3
transaction
259962e76a1c0581c04a85d0f275c621c860d5a681c91e99fae2f375827f3926
spent
true